FIA today announced the 10 startups that have been chosen to exhibit in the 2023 Innovators Pavilion, FIA's annual showcase for fintech startups relevant to derivatives trading and clearing. The Pavilion takes place during FIA’s Futures and Options Expo, which brings together traders, brokers and other market professionals from a wide range of firms in the derivatives industry. The conference will be held on 2-3 October in Chicago.
"We are excited to welcome these 10 startups to this year's FIA Expo and help them connect with potential partners and customers in the listed and cleared derivatives markets," said Walt Lukken, FIA president and chief executive officer. "Innovation is the hallmark of the derivatives industry, and this program is a key part of our efforts to support new products, new technologies and new business models."
The 10 startups were selected by an independent committee of industry experts drawn from FIA member firms as well as venture capital firms focused on capital markets. The startups were chosen based on the innovativeness of their products and services and their relevance to the global futures, options and swaps markets.

"This year's group includes startups focused on many different potential applications, including artificial intelligence, climate risk, cryptocurrencies, commodity trading, collateral management and data analytics," said Will Acworth, FIA’s senior vice president of data, publications and research. "I want to thank the members of the selection committee for their work in sifting through the applications and choosing such a highly qualified and diverse group of startups for our program."
This year's selection committee included experts from Akuna Capital, Barclays, Chicago Trading Company, Citadel Securities, DRW Venture Capital, GH Financials, Illuminate Financial, IMC, Optiver, Peak6, Société Générale, and Two Sigma.
As the leading trade association for the listed and cleared derivatives markets, FIA has worked for decades to promote advances in the trading and clearing of derivatives. The annual Innovators Pavilion has become a core element of FIA's commitment to accelerate the adoption of fintech solutions in these markets.
Each year FIA invites a select group of fintech startups to showcase their solutions for the derivatives industry at the FIA Expo, the industry's largest trade show. Since the first Innovators Pavilion in 2015, more than 150 startups from around the world have participated in the event.
